Flashcards

Main participants of the war

France and Britain were the main participants in the French and Indian War.

Country that joined France

Spain joined the side of France towards the end of the war.

Treaty ending the war

The Treaty of Paris ended the French and Indian War.

Negotiating superpowers

Britain, France, and Spain were the superpowers at the peace negotiations in 1762.
